About Karen M Switkowski

Karen M Switkowski is a scholar working on Obstetrics and Gynecology, Pediatrics, Perinatology and Child Health and Public Health, Environmental and Occupational Health, having authored 41 papers that have together received 663 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Obesity, Physical Activity, Diet (15 papers), Birth, Development, and Health (14 papers) and Gestational Diabetes Research and Management (10 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Obstetrics and Gynecology (121 citations), Applied Microbiology and Biotechnology (24 citations) and Pediatrics, Perinatology and Child Health (196 citations). Karen M Switkowski has collaborated with scholars based in United States, Canada and Singapore. Frequent co-authors include Emily Oken, Sheryl L. Rifas‐Shiman, Paul F. Jacques, Marie‐France Hivert, Matthew W. Gillman, Abby F. Fleisch, Véronique Gingras, Izzuddin M. Aris, Aviva Must and Genève Allison. Their work appears in journals such as PLoS ONE, American Journal of Clinical Nutrition and The Journal of Clinical Endocrinology & Metabolism.
